Global Brand Manager

1 week ago


City Of London, United Kingdom Brown-Forman Australia Pty. Ltd. Full time

Global Brand Manager (Communication Lead), Diplomatico Meaningful Work From Day One You will orchestrate Diplomático's holistic global communications strategy, focusing on building brand fame and cultural relevance to drive desirability. This strategic role is responsible for translating the brand's heritage into a modern, compelling narrative that cuts through the noise and reinforces our brand positioning. This working style for this role is 4 days a week out of our modern office in Fitzrovia in central London with Fridays working from home. The closing date to apply for this role is the 2nd of November at 6pm. What You Can Expect Leads the development and execution of the global communications strategy and integrated media plans. Serves as the primary global contact and strategic leader for all external agencies (PR, media, creative, digital, influencer). Spearheads the global planning, execution, and optimization of integrated marketing campaigns across diverse channels. Provides visionary guidance for the global adaptation and creation of all advertising creative and content strategies. Oversees the performance measurement and analysis of all global communications initiatives, driving continuous optimization. Manages Diplomatico's global brand reputation, including the development of strategic crisis communications plans. Fosters seamless cross‑functional collaboration with market teams, product development, insights and sales to support business growth. Manages the dedicated global communications budget, ensuring efficient resource allocation to maximize impact. Champions Diplomatico's distinct brand voice and ensures strict adherence to brand guidelines and legal compliance. What You Bring to the Table Minimum of 6 years experience in developing and implementing holistic, integrated global communications or marketing strategies. Proven ability to lead and manage multiple external agencies and drive integrated execution. Deep and current understanding of the evolving global media landscape, specifically how to leverage digital and influencer channels to generate cultural momentum. Demonstrated experience in crafting compelling narratives and guiding premium content creation for a global consumer audience. Strong analytical skills to interpret complex communication data and drive measurable performance optimization. Demonstrated ability to build and maintain effective working relationships and influence diverse global teams and senior stakeholders. What Makes You Unique Experience with luxury goods or luxury wine and spirits – either in agency or on the brand side. Experience leading communications for a brand that achieved outsized growth through disruptive, non‑traditional marketing. Demonstrated ability to adapt communication strategies to diverse cultural contexts and market nuances on a global scale. Who We Are We believe great people build great brands. And we know there is Nothing Better in the Market than a career at Brown‑Forman. Being a part of Brown‑Forman means you will grow both personally and professionally. You will have the opportunity to solve problems, seize opportunities, and generate bold ideas. You will belong to a place where teamwork matters and where you are encouraged to bring your best self to work. What We Offer Total Rewards at Brown‑Forman is designed to engage our people to ensure sustainable and profitable growth for generations to come. As a premium spirits company, we offer equitable pay structures for individual and company performance alongside a premium employee experience. We offer a range of premium benefits that reflect our company values and meet the needs of our diverse workforce. Brown‑Forman Corporation is committed to equality of opportunity in all aspects of employment. It is the policy of Brown‑Forman Corporation to provide full and equal employment opportunities to all employees and potential employees without regard to race, color, religion, national or ethnic origin, veteran status, age, gender, gender identity or expression, sexual orientation, genetic information, physical or mental disability or any other legally protected status. #J-18808-Ljbffr


  • Global Brand Lead

    3 days ago


    City Of London, United Kingdom Calibre Global Consulting Full time

    OverviewGlobal Head of Brand & Communications – Energy & Power TransmissionLocation: Flexible within EU / US / Canada / Australia / Latin AmericaWe are seeking a dynamic Global Head of Brand & Communications to shape and lead our international brand presence in the energy and power transmission sector. This is a strategic leadership role that will drive...

  • Global Brand Manager

    22 hours ago


    City Of London, United Kingdom Imperial Brands PLC Full time

    OverviewJoin to apply for the Global Brand Manager - Hybrid role at Imperial Brands PLC.Are you ready to take a brand to new heights? As a Global Brand Manager, you’ll drive brand recognition, relevance, and engagement for our consumers worldwide. This role focuses on evolving the brand to unlock growth potential and shape consumer perceptions in fresh,...

  • Global Brand Lead

    5 days ago


    London, United Kingdom Calibre Global Consulting Full time

    About the job Global Head of Brand & Communications Energy & Power Transmission Location: Flexible within EU / US / Canada / Australia / Latin America We are seeking a dynamic Global Head of Brand & Communications to shape and lead our international brand presence in the energy and power transmission sector. This is a strategic leadership role that will...

  • Global Brand Lead

    1 week ago


    London, Greater London, United Kingdom Calibre Global Consulting Full time £80,000 - £120,000 per year

    About the jobGlobal Head of Brand & Communications Energy & Power TransmissionLocation: Flexible within EU / US / Canada / Australia / Latin AmericaWe are seeking a dynamic Global Head of Brand & Communications to shape and lead our international brand presence in the energy and power transmission sector. This is a strategic leadership role that will drive...


  • City Of London, United Kingdom Brown-Forman Australia Pty. Ltd. Full time

    We believe great people build great brands. And we know there is Nothing Better in the Market than a career at Brown-Forman. Being a part of Brown-Forman means you will grow both personally and professionally. You will have the opportunity to solve problems, seize opportunities, and generate bold ideas. You will belong to a place where teamwork matters and...


  • City Of London, United Kingdom Unilever Full time

    Job Title: Global Assistant Brand & Innovation Manager Business Function: Marketing Location: London 100VE Overview It is an exciting time to be part of the Fabric Enhancers team, one of Unilever’s iconic brands with 1.5Bn EUR turnover and used in over 150 million households around the world. Big shifts are happening in how fabrics are worn and washed, and...


  • City Of London, United Kingdom Guardian Jobs Full time

    Join our team Location: London, Moorgate Working mode: Hybrid Maternity cover for 12 months Employment type: Full Time Salary: C£85,000 pa Are you an accomplished leader with a track record in shaping and leading global brand identity for large established organisations? ICAEW is seeking a Head of Global Brand to direct our brand strategy and enhance our...


  • City Of London, United Kingdom PlayStation Global Full time

    A leading gaming company is seeking a Brand Marketing Specialist to support marketing strategies for high-profile game titles. Key responsibilities include managing marketing campaigns and collaborating with global teams. Ideal candidates will have experience in digital marketing and strong communication skills. The role offers a hybrid working model and...

  • Global Brands

    2 weeks ago


    City Of London, United Kingdom Minimal Full time

    Global Brands - Senior Account Manager page is loaded## Global Brands - Senior Account Managerlocations: London, United Kingdomtime type: Full timeposted on: Posted Todayjob requisition id: R0042663is a technology company. We believe the camera presents the greatest opportunity to improve the way people live and communicate. Snap contributes to human...


  • London, United Kingdom S&P Global Full time

    **About the Role**: **Grade Level (for internal use)**: 08 Global Employer Branding Specialist **The Team**: The Talent Acquisition Impact team is composed of innovation specialists, recruiters, and an Employer Branding specialist based in various global locations, bringing diverse perspectives and expertise across the entire Talent Acquisition function. We...